What to Discover Before You Buy A Fence

Break out of your comfort zone when you've decided to buy a fence because you have a lot of work to do. It's just like any other area where there's a fair bit of information to take in. The smartest way to help yourself and potentially save money and headaches is through gaining knowledge about all this. Getting a new fence almost demands you get your stuff in one sock unless you want to go into it blindly.

The single most important thing, aside from price, is the function of the fence you want. If you happen to not see what you want, then think about custom fencing because they're in the market but more expensive. Multifunction fences do exist, and in fact that's a whole other area of fencing and they cost more, though. Resist all efforts by sales people to talk you into something you do not want, and you have to stick to your guns and get exactly what you're willing to pay for.

In the even that something goes wrong later on, you want the contractor to fix it - but that will depend on the warranty. What you will always find is that a contractor may not say much about this, and that's why you really need to bring that up early in the discussion before you buy anything. A locally branded contractor who does fencing will not do anything to damage the business reputation, and that's not the case with a lesser known business, usually. You will need to find a service to install it, and it's best to go with a private business so you are sure that they're professionals.

You may not be able to install the fence, and that's fine because they're sure to get it right if you pick a good contractor.
